Transmission Control Modules

Transmission Control Modules are electronic devices found in vehicles that are responsible for controlling the transmission system. These modules use inputs from various sensors to determine the optimal shift points for the transmission, ensuring smooth and efficient operation. They also monitor factors such as vehicle speed, engine load, and throttle position to make real-time adjustments to the transmission's performance. Additionally, Transmission Control Modules can store diagnostic trouble codes to help mechanics identify and troubleshoot issues with the transmission system.
